TIP! Keep in mind that stocks aren’t simply just a piece of paper you purchase and sell when trading. If you own a stock, you actually own a small part of the company, and you should take that investment seriously.

Stocks are more than just pieces of paper that is bought and sold. When you own some, you own a piece of a company. You become vested in the earnings and a claim on assets that belong to the company. You can often make your voice heard by voting in elections for the companies corporate leadership.

Exercise the voting rights granted to you have common stock. Voting can be done at the yearly meeting held for shareholders or by mail.
